  • 简介:摘要:肠黏膜是人体中一道天然的预防细菌的屏障,它不仅可以保护人体胃肠道受损,还能防止病毒等有害细菌进入血液中。是人体必不可少的保护屏障。随着人们生活水平的提高,饮食规律及起居不规范,如暴饮暴食、熬夜、食物单一,或不良嗜好,如吸烟,喝酒,经常食用熏烤类食物及饮用刺激性饮料,这些都会紊乱胃肠道菌群失调、破坏酸碱平衡,进而引起胃肠道粘膜损伤。胃肠道粘膜损伤不仅会影响人体的免疫机制,还会引起胃肠道溃疡,胃肠道糜烂,胃肠道出血等一系列疾病。严重者还会引起胃肠道恶性肿瘤。
